Output bde6def523239bb278b3df6b1e80a3f232bcb7145ffe7b571af935421372d8e2:949

value
881132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a8c65b1579656e275dab0bc089b482c1460184 OP_EQUAL
address
34wZkwP3WxFD95U89D9vXALUSzNBVjTRJU
transaction
bde6def523239bb278b3df6b1e80a3f232bcb7145ffe7b571af935421372d8e2
spent
true